By Plane: The quickest way to get from Prague to Florence is by plane. There are several airlines that operate this route, including Czech Airlines, Ryanair, and Vueling. You can find direct flights that take around 2 hours, or you can opt for a connecting flight with a longer layover.

Tip: Book your flight in advance to get the best deals and avoid last-minute price hikes.

By Train: If you’re looking for a more scenic route, consider taking the train. There are several options available, including high-speed trains that take around 9 hours and slower regional trains that can take up to 14 hours.

Tip: Consider booking a sleeper car if you opt for the longer journey. This way, you can relax and even get some sleep on the train.

By Bus: Another option is to take the bus. This is usually the cheapest option but also takes the longest time. Buses run between Prague and Florence daily, with travel times ranging from 16-20 hours.

Tip: Make sure to pack snacks and entertainment for the long journey.
